Also make sure you are driving your optocouplers with respect to ground, and *not* tying one leg to the 3.3v or 5v lines. The inputs to many drivers seem to hearken back to TTL logic days and are screen printed with the optocoupler inputs listed as pulling down from V+, which besides inverting your output, also does not work well on the BBB. Switching from using [3.3v, pin] to [ground, pin] solved a similar issue somewhere on this forum.
